The practical protocol is dull and it works: smaller meals, stop eating at the first sign of fullness rather than at the end of the plate, drop the fat fraction of meals in the two days after dosing, and do not lie down straight after eating. Most of what people call unmanageable nausea is a meal-size and meal-composition problem interacting with a stomach that is emptying slowly.
